ArvinMeritor commits to FreedomLine, will discontinue Meritor production

Sep 1, 2006 12:00 PM

ArvinMeritor has decided to place greater emphasis on the sales and marketing of the FreedomLine automated manual transmission by ZF Friedrichshafen in Germany. ArvinMeritor will discontinue manufacturing Meritor manual transmissions, effective in January 2007, due to dynamics that have severely limited the company's addressable markets.

The company will honor all current manual transmission orders placed with ArvinMeritor, and all orders received before September 2006 provided they are to be delivered no later than January 2007. All Meritor manual transmissions sold and in service will continue to be supported by the company's sales, service, and aftermarket parts support teams.

Production of the FreedomLine will remain in ArvinMeritor's Laurinburg NC facility.
